How to Restore One-Touch Window Control on Golf 7?

To restore malfunctioning one-touch window control, lift the window button to raise the window completely. Keep holding for 3-5 seconds before releasing. Then press the button to lower the window fully, maintaining pressure for another 3-5 seconds before releasing. Test the one-touch function again, which should now work properly. Below are additional details about one-touch window control: 1. Temporary power interruption in related components often causes one-touch function failure, which can be resolved by resetting the system. 2. Each power window has an Electronic Control Module (ECM). When pressing the control switch, ECM receives signals - if pressed for less than 0.5s, ECM executes full open/close; if pressed longer than 0.5s, ECM maintains power until switch release.
